Pamela Bennett is the State Master Gardener volunteer coordinator for Ohio, and is the Horticulture Educator and Director for Ohio State University Extension in Clark County. She has a degree in landscape horticulture. Pam specializes in herbaceous ornamental plant trials and evaluates more than 200 varieties of annuals and two genera of ornamental grasses.
Pam writes a weekly gardening column for the Springfield News and Sun and the Dayton Daily News, & authors the bi-monthly Ask the Expert Column for Ohio Gardening magazine. Pam teaches in Ohio, nationally, and internationally on a variety of horticulture topics. She recently co-authored the award-winning book, GARDEN-PEDIA: an A-Z guide to gardening terms.

Dr. Laura Deeter is actively teaching woody and herbaceous plant identification, outdoor gardening, perennial production and landscape design at the OSU Agricultural Technical Institute (ATI) in Wooster, Ohio.
